服务器文件的url地址是什么格式

不及物动词 其他 223

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器文件的URL地址一般都遵循一定的格式,格式如下:

    1. HTTP协议:HTTP协议是最常用的协议,用于传输超文本。HTTP协议的URL格式为:
      http://hostname%5B:port%5D/path/to/file
      其中,hostname代表服务器主机名或IP地址,port代表可选的端口号,path/to/file代表服务器上文件的路径。例如:http://www.example.com/files/index.html

    2. HTTPS协议:HTTPS协议是基于HTTP协议的安全版本,使用SSL或TLS加密传输数据。HTTPS协议的URL格式与HTTP协议相同,只是协议部分为https。例如:https://www.example.com/files/index.html

    3. FTP协议:FTP协议用于文件传输,FTP服务器的URL格式为:
      ftp://%5Busername:password@%5Dhostname%5B:port%5D/path/to/file
      其中,username代表登录FTP服务器的用户名(可选),password代表登录密码(可选),hostname代表FTP服务器主机名或IP地址,port代表可选的端口号,默认为21,path/to/file代表服务器上文件的路径。例如:ftp://anonymous:password@ftp.example.com/files/index.html

    4. 文件协议:文件协议用于在本地计算机上访问文件,URL格式为:
      file://localhost/path/to/file
      其中,localhost代表本地计算机,path/to/file代表文件的路径。例如:file://localhost/C:/path/to/file.txt

    需要注意的是,不同的服务器和应用程序可能会有一些特殊的URL格式,上述仅为常见的格式。在实际使用中,还需要根据具体情况来确定URL的格式。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器文件的URL地址通常是以下格式:

    1. HTTP协议:最常见的服务器文件URL地址格式是以HTTP协议开头,如:http://www.example.com/file.html。其中,http://表示使用HTTP协议,www.example.com是服务器的域名或IP地址,file.html是文件的路径和文件名。

    2. HTTPS协议:如果服务器文件需要通过安全的HTTPS协议传输,URL地址会以https://开头,如:https://www.example.com/file.html。HTTPS协议提供了加密和身份验证机制,用于保护数据传输的安全性。

    3. FTP协议:除了HTTP协议,还可以使用FTP协议来获取服务器文件。FTP协议的URL格式为:ftp://username:password@ftp.example.com/file.html。其中,ftp表示使用FTP协议,username和password是登录FTP服务器的用户名和密码,ftp.example.com是FTP服务器的域名或IP地址,file.html是文件的路径和文件名。

    4. 文件路径:如果服务器上的文件存储在本地文件系统中,URL地址可以直接使用文件路径来访问,如:file:///path/to/file.html。其中,file:///表示使用本地文件访问协议,/path/to/file.html是文件的绝对路径。

    5. 动态URL:除了静态文件,服务器还可以根据请求动态生成内容。此时,URL地址可能包含参数,用于传递请求的信息。例如:http://www.example.com/page.php?id=123。其中,id=123是用于传递请求的参数,服务器可以根据id的值来生成相应的内容。

    需要注意的是,URL地址是区分大小写的,而且特殊字符需要进行编码。常见的编码方式是使用百分号加上字符的ASCII码的十六进制表示,例如空格的编码是%20。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器文件的 URL 地址通常由以下几个部分组成:

    1. 协议(Protocol):URL 的协议部分指定了用于访问资源的协议,例如 HTTP、HTTPS、FTP 等。常见的 Web 资源一般使用 HTTP 或 HTTPS 协议。

    2. 主机名(Host):URL 的主机名部分指定了存储资源的服务器的域名或 IP 地址。例如,http://www.example.com 或 192.168.0.1。

    3. 端口号(Port):URL 的端口号部分指定了服务器的网络端口号,用于标识服务器上不同的服务。如果 URL 中未指定端口号,会使用默认端口号。例如,HTTP 默认端口号为 80,HTTPS 默认端口号为 443。

    4. 路径(Path):URL 的路径部分指定了服务器上存储资源的具体路径。路径可以是绝对路径或相对路径。绝对路径以斜杠(/)开头,相对路径不以斜杠开头。

    5. 查询字符串(Query String):URL 的查询字符串部分用于向服务器传递参数。查询字符串以问号(?)开头,多个参数之间用 ampersand(&)分隔。例如,?param1=value1&param2=value2。

    6. 片段标识符(Fragment Identifier):URL 的片段标识符部分用于指定文档中的特定位置,例如 HTML 文档中的锚点。片段标识符以井号(#)开头,后面跟着具体的标识符。

    下面是一个示例 URL:

    http://www.example.com:80/path/to/resource?param1=value1&param2=value2#section1
    

    在这个示例中:

    • 协议部分为 http://
    • 主机名部分为 www.example.com
    • 端口号部分为 :80
    • 路径部分为 /path/to/resource
    • 查询字符串部分为 ?param1=value1&param2=value2
    • 片段标识符部分为 #section1

    需要注意的是,URL 中的特殊字符需要进行编码,例如空格应该被替换为 %20

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部